Sharjah Museum Authority Announces Free Entry This Ramadan


The authorities said that all museums would only be open in the morning during the final 10 days of Ramadan and would be closed entirely on the 29th and 30th.

The Sharjah Museum of Islamic Civilization offers tourists an exclusive chance to learn about Islamic civilisation. You can search for details about its five pillars, rites associated with pilgrimage, and scientific achievements.

The timings for the museum have changed for the holy month of Ramadan. On Saturday through Thursday, the museums are open from 9:00 am to 2:00 pm and from 9:00 pm to 11:00 pm.

List Of Exhibitions You Can Witness Here

A model of the Black Stone, fragments of the kiswah, the black silk cloth that covers Al Ka’ba, a sizable collection of photographs of Al Ka’ba and the Grand Mosque in Makkah, and a photograph of the rock that Muslims believe Prophet Abraham stood upon while erecting Al Ka’ba are all displayed in the Abu Bakr Gallery of Islamic Faith at the museum. Basically, you can learn a lot about Islamic heritage and culture at this Sharjah Museum.

This museum has much to teach you, from manuscripts of the Holy Qur’an to the development of Islamic bookbinding craft.

The Sharjah Museum has also created interactive learning experiences for the visually impaired crowd. With just a touch, reading information about various reproductions of objects from Braille explanation booklets is now possible for people.
